## Artifact Signing — SpokeSort

Notes for the eng sync. All SpokeSort rebalancer builds are now signed before hitting the depot fleet. Unsigned binaries get rejected by the kiosk updater as of 4.2. Pipeline: CI builds, signs, publishes checksums; rollout gated on verification. Two incidents last quarter traced to stale keys on the Millbrae staging boxes — those are retired. Rotation cadence is quarterly, owned by the platform crew at Tindervale Systems. Current verification uses the public signing key shown here.

signing key of bagap-yawep = bky13_TbfT6ZMUoGJo2

Welcome to the Squatterhawk on-call rotation at Pellwright Labs. When the typo-squatting scanner flags a suspicious package name, first confirm the Levenshtein threshold in the active policy bundle, then check whether the registry snapshot is newer than the ruleset. If they disagree, pause quarantine actions rather than auto-blocking, since false positives disrupt partner feeds. Document every decision in the shift log. Before escalating, capture the scanner's build identity by quoting the token printed below.

session token of tajef-bageg = htk21_5d90d574934f3ccae6437

Subject: Quickstore 4.2 — bloom filter now fronts the KV layer

Plugin authors: starting with this release, Quickstore places a bloom filter ahead of the key-value store. Negative lookups return faster; false positives fall through safely. No API changes are required on your side. Verify your plugin against the staging build referenced below.

session token of fahif-tadup = htk3_9c7

Alert: stringharvest, the translation-string extraction script for Moonvale apps, failed its nightly run. Extraction halted mid-parse; translation bundles are now stale. Localized builds will ship with yesterday's strings until resolved. Restarting the job is safe but check parser logs first. The runbook with triage steps is on the internal page.

runbook for tafof-yawif: https://confluence.tolvaqsys.internal/display/display/browse/pages/7be3

Ticket: Staging env misconfigured for Siftgate bloom filter

The bloom layer in front of the Pellet KV store is rejecting all lookups in staging because the env file was copied from the dev template without credentials. False-positive tuning values are fine; only the auth line is missing. To unblock the weekly demo, the Pellet admission secret must be set on the following line.

env line for yaguf-fajop: LEDGER_TOKEN13=fb08984397349